It is more than 40 years since BA last connected its main base, London Heathrow, with the Channel Island of Guernsey. I was on board the first departure from the isle – a notable operation with both pilots and all but one of the cabin crew being Guernsey born and bread.While I waited for the flight I talked to Zoe Gosling, Lead Marketing Officer at Visit Guernsey – who had just flown in from Heathrow.This podcast is free, as is Independent Travel's weekly newsletter.
